Exploring Your Financing Options
The first step in your remodeling journey is to explore the different financing options available. One popular choice is a home equity loan, which allows homeowners to borrow against the equity they've built in their homes. This can often provide lower interest rates compared to other loan types. However, it's essential to understand the risks involved, especially if market conditions shift and property values decline.
Another option is a personal loan, which may not require collateral but often comes with higher interest rates. While this may seem less risky, borrowers should carefully assess their repayment abilities before proceeding. Additionally, utilizing a credit card for smaller, manageable expenses can be tempting due to the convenience it provides, but tread carefully to avoid crippling debt.
Budgeting: The Key to Success
Work out a comprehensive budget that outlines your projected costs from start to finish. This should include materials, labor, and unexpected contingencies—often, these unforeseen costs can add a significant amount of stress to your project. However, conducting thorough research and obtaining quotes from multiple contractors can mitigate these risks and provide you with clearer expectations.
Alternative Approaches: Savings and Grants
Aside from loans, many homeowners overlook the option of financing through personal savings. Setting aside a specific amount over time can help cushion the financial blow of your renovation. Additionally, look into local or state grants for home renovations that promote energy efficiency or support low-income families. This can be a fantastic way to offset some costs while also improving your home’s sustainability.
The Power of Planning: Timing Your Remodel
Timing is everything when it comes to a remodel. Certain seasons may allow for cheaper labor costs, especially in the less busy months of late fall and winter in Fresno. Understanding the rhythms of construction and local market conditions can save homeowners a significant amount of money and stress.

Common Myths: Debunking Remodeling Misconceptions
Before diving into your remodel, it’s essential to address common misconceptions. Many believe that your return on investment (ROI) will be guaranteed, but this isn't always the case. Market conditions fluctuate, and not every improvement yields equal returns. Knowledge is power, so educating yourself on what renovations generally have the best ROI—like kitchen or bathroom upgrades—can guide your decisions.
